WHAT IS THE POLICY ADVISORY BOARD?

The Policy Advisory Board (PAB) brings together global leaders — policy pros, youth voices, academics, and business thinkers — to make sure we stay sharp, globally relevant and politically sharp — but never partisan.

It’s pro-bono, high-impact, and built like a civic think tank… but more fun.

Why it matters?

Keep our games and service outcomes bias-free, accurate, and multilingual

Represent diverse political contexts and lived experiences

Connect us with mission-aligned orgs and funders

Help shape civic & political education at a global scale

PUBLIC POLICY 🇪🇬


  • Basma ElEtreby is an impact driven policy advisor with more than 14 years of experience across the Middle East & Africa (MEA), where she has worked with and for government entities, think tanks, consultancies, INGOs and donor agencies. Her most recent role as Director of Strategy & Growth at Moharram & Partners (M&P), the premier public policy firm in MEA, entailed working with fortune 500 companies on their commercial and non-commercial partnerships, and strategic initiatives, in more than 40 MEA markets. Prior to M&P, ElEtreby was one of the founding team members of public policy consulting firm, NGC International Advisory (NGCIA), before it got acquired by APCO Worldwide. Her expertise also ranges from spearheading efforts to apply the Principles of Responsible Banking (PRB) reporting in MENA, as Policy and Outreach Consultant at DCarbon Global, to consulting MNCs on regional geopolitical risks. She has also advised government entities on political risks, through blending insights from across sectors and geographies, while working for the Abu Dhabi-based think tank, Future for Advanced Research and Studies. These distinctive angles, to name a few, have offered her a comprehensive understanding and in-depth lens within global and public affairs. 

    ElEtreby, a mother of two girls, holds a Bachelors and Masters in Political Science from the American University in Cairo. She also attained Harvard’s Strategy Execution for Public Leadership course and London School of Economics (LSE) Public Policy Analysis course.

GOVERNMENT RELATIONS 🇰🇿 PUBLIC AFFAIRS 🇰🇿


  • Mira Kuderinova is a seasoned public affairs professional working at the nexus of tech and policy in Central Asia. As Government Relations Director at Kolesa Group and a Council Member at the Digital Kazakhstan Association, she’s spent the past several years translating the language of innovation into actionable policy—making space for digital transformation in Kazakhstan’s regulatory landscape.

    Mira’s background in political science, with Master’s degrees earned in Russia and Italy, gives her a sharp geopolitical lens and a multilingual fluency in navigating complexity. At Kolesa Group, she has led critical legislative negotiations, crisis communications, and the integration of public services into private platforms—advocating not just for business, but for users’ access to civic tools.

🇩🇪 POLITICAL INNOVATION 🇳🇿

  • Daniel is a democratic systems and political innovation expert from New Zealand who has spent the last decade building and supporting collaborative global initiatives to address shared challenges and affect positive change at the intersection of politics and technology. From leading the development of transparency software for journalists and investigative researchers to gamefying, decision-making challenges as team-building workshops for NGOs and SMEs. From co-creating innovation and best practice briefings for political leaders to forging a global advocacy network around citizen participation in space policy.

    With a career spanning international development, tech entrepreneurship, government advisory, policy advocacy, formal diplomacy, journalism and research, Daniel has enjoyed working across more than a dozen countries including Egypt, India, the United States and Australia. From 2010 to 2015 he was based in Cairo studying the shifting dynamics of social trust networks during the Arab Spring revolutions. From 2015-2018 he served as a policy and public affairs diplomat for the British Foreign Commonwealth Office. From 2018-2021, he lived...all over the place. And for the last few years, he has been based in Berlin, where his most recent roles have included serving as a Senior Advisor and Head of Product Development for the Innovation in Politics Institute, Editor and Product Developer for democracy-technologies.org and father of two.

    A belligerent optimist and a democracy-loving sci-fi nerd to the core, Daniel believes deeply in our capacity to build better futures by imagining them in detail and then strategically working backwards towards them - always asking "What would that require?" step by step, until we arrive at the present, and then doing the first thing on the list.
